The historical significance of nurse tattoos can be traced back to the evolution of the nursing profession itself. Nursing has long been associated with care and compassion, with figures like Florence Nightingale and Clara Barton playing pivotal roles in shaping modern nursing. Tattoos honoring these figures or the profession as a whole serve as a reminder of the dedication and sacrifices made by nurses throughout history. During wartime, nurses were often seen as angels of mercy, providing care to wounded soldiers, which further solidified their revered status. Nurse tattoos can also reflect the personal history of the wearer, commemorating their journey through nursing school or significant milestones in their career.
